Italian ‘Art Police’ Raid Dalí Show, Discovering a Surreal 21 Suspected Fakes.
It seems even the world of high art isn’t immune to a good old-fashioned ‘oops!’ moment! ? Italy’s specialized art squad, the Carabinieri, swooped into a Parma exhibition dedicated to none other than the master of surrealism himself, Salvador Dalí. The mission? To confiscate a whopping 21 works that are now under heavy suspicion of being about as authentic as a mustache glued onto a potato. ? The squad had to consult the Gala-Salvador Dalí Foundation in Catalonia, which probably involved a lot of head-scratching and comparing melting clocks.
